Cedar Rapids vs Memphis

Fair Market Rent Comparison — HUD 2025 Data

Quick Answer

Cedar Rapids is 2% cheaper for renters. A 2-bedroom rents for $800/mo vs $819/mo in Memphis — saving $228/year.

Rent by Unit Size

Unit SizeCedar RapidsMemphisDifference
Studio$530$560$30
1 Bedroom$637$682$45
2 Bedrooms$800$819$19
3 Bedrooms$966$1,011$45
4 Bedrooms$1,168$1,184$16
Median Income$45,870$44,652$1,218
